Hi! I looked up my reciepe for chinese plum sauce.
Chinese Plum Sauce
by Andrea Chesman
150 Reciepes Apples tp Zucchini Book
Lf you are looking for something special to make for holiday
gifts,this is one to consider.Although plum sauce is traditionally served with egg rolls,it goes wonderfully with many other Chinese and Indian dishes.Plum sauce is also an excellent condiment with chicken and duck.
3 pounds plums(Italian plums are recommended)I use Santa Rosa
2 pounds freestone-type peaches( I use any kind of peach)
3 sweet red peppers,diced
4 large cloves garlic,minced
1 onion,minced
4 cups cider vinegar
1 1/2 cups water
1/2 cup cooking sherry
1 teaspoon soy sauce
1 1/2 cup white sugar
1 1/2 cups packed light brown sugar
1 tablespoon ground ginger
1 tablespoon pickling salt
1 tablespoon dry mustard
1 teaspoon cayenne
1 teaspoon cinnamon
1 teaspoon ground cardamom
Steam blanch the plums and peaches for 2 minutes over boiling water.Blanch no more than 1 pound at a time.Slip the skins off the fruit,slice,and remove the stones.Chop the peaches.
In a large preserving kettle,combine all the ingredients.Bring to a boil and simmer until the fruit fall apart and syrup is quite thick,1 1/2-2 hours.Stir frequently to avoid scorching.
Ladle the hot sauce into clean,hot half-pint jars,leaving 1/2 inch headspace.Seal.
Process in a boiling water bath canner for 10 minutes,
Remove and let cool they will seal.
I also add more sugar and liquid smoke to make a bbq sauce flavor it to your taste. Enjoy!
